Full-wave rectifiers are commonly used in power supplies to convert AC to DC, providing the steady DC voltage needed for electronic devices. There are two main types of full-wave rectifiers: Center-Tapped Full-Wave Rectifier and Bridge Rectifier. A Bridge Rectifier uses four diodes in a bridge configuration to convert both the positive and negative halves of the AC input into DC. ▶️ During the positive half-cycle of the AC waveform, diodes D1 and D2 are forward-biased, allowing current to flow through the load in the direction indicated. Diodes D3 and D4 are reverse-biased during this half-cycle and do not conduct. ▶️ During the negative half-cycle of the AC waveform, diodes D3 and D4 become forward-biased, allowing current to flow through the load in the same direction as during the positive half-cycle. Diodes D1 and D2 are reverse-biased in this cycle, preventing current from flowing through them. This consistent direction of current through the load results in a continuous DC output, as seen in the rectified waveform. In practical applications, a smoothing capacitor is often added to the output of the rectifier to smooth out the ripples in the DC output, providing a more steady and smooth DC voltage. Diode: A diode is a semiconductor device that allows current to flow one way, blocking it the other. It's like an electronic check valve. Rectifier: A rectifier converts AC (alternating current) to DC (direct current) using diodes. Common types include half-wave and full-wave rectifiers. Half wave and full wave rectifiers are devices that convert alternating current (AC) into direct current (DC). Let's differentiate them considering the use of the same output capacitors and the same load: When both use the same output capacitors and the same load: - The capacitor in a full wave rectifier will be more effective in smoothing the ripple, as the frequency of the voltage pulses is double that in the half wave rectifier. - In both cases, the capacitor's capacity determines how much ripple is smoothed. A larger capacitor results in less ripple. - The load will receive a more constant and less pulsating voltage in the full wave rectifier due to the lower ripple and higher pulse frequency. The image shows two types of bridge rectifiers: the first one at the top consists of four separate diodes, and the second one at the bottom is a single integrated circuit containing the same components internally. A bridge rectifier is a circuit responsible for converting alternating current (AC), which constantly changes direction, into direct current (DC) that flows in one direction, which is what most electronic devices need to operate. How does it work? (Working principle) The operation is based on the property of a diode, which allows current to pass in only one direction and prevents it in the opposite direction. The bridge operates through two cycles: 1. Positive half of the wave: • When the current comes in a certain direction, a pair of opposite diodes (e.g., the first and third diodes) open the path for the current to pass through the load (device) from positive to negative. • Meanwhile. the other nair of diodes Negative half of the wave: • When the alternating current reverses direction, the first pair of diodes closes, while the second pair (the second and fourth diodes) opens the path. • The secret here is that the diodes are arranged so that the current passes through the device in the same direction as it did in the first half. Components of the device in the image: • Input (AC): There are two terminals through which the alternating current enters (often symbolized by the ~ sign). • Output (DC): There are two terminals that output the direct current (positive + and negative -).
